Gradient of logistic loss
WebDec 11, 2024 · Logistic regression is the go-to linear classification algorithm for two-class problems. It is easy to implement, easy to understand and gets great results on a wide variety of problems, even … WebMar 5, 2016 · The logistic loss function is given by: So the Prox Operator is given by: The above is a smooth convex function. Hence any stationary point is a minimum. Looking at its derivative yields: There is no closed form when the derivative vanishes. As @ AlexShtof suggested you could use Newton Method to solve this. Yet since we have nice form we …
Gradient of logistic loss
Did you know?
WebApr 18, 2024 · Multiclass logistic regression is also called multinomial logistic regression and softmax regression. It is used when we want to predict more than 2 classes. ... Now we have calculated the loss function and the gradient function. We can implement the loss and gradient functions in Python, and implement a very basic … WebOct 14, 2024 · The loss function of logistic regression is doing this exactly which is called Logistic Loss. See as below. See as below. If y = 1, looking at the plot below on left, when prediction = 1, the cost = 0, …
WebAug 23, 2016 · I would like to understand how the gradient and hessian of the logloss function are computed in an xgboost sample script. I've simplified the function to take numpy arrays, and generated y_hat and ... The log loss function is the sum of where . The gradient (with respect to p) is then however in the code its . Likewise the second derivative ... WebGradient Descent for Logistic Regression The training loss function is J( ) = Xn n=1 n y n Tx n + log(1 h (x n)) o: Recall that r [ log(1 h (x))] = h (x)x: You can run gradient descent …
WebLoss function which GBT tries to minimize. For classification, must be "logistic". For regression, must be one of "squared" (L2) and "absolute" (L1), default is "squared". seed. integer seed for random number generation. subsamplingRate. Fraction of the training data used for learning each decision tree, in range (0, 1]. minInstancesPerNode WebThe logistic loss is used in the LogitBoost algorithm . The minimizer of for the logistic loss function can be directly found from equation (1) as This function is undefined when or …
WebAug 15, 2024 · Gradient of Log Loss: ... Which then to be known as the derivative/gradient of our logistic regression’s cost function. Below is the gradient of our cost function with respect to w (weights). If ...
WebFeb 7, 2024 · I am trying to develop the model from scratch and I have reviewed a lot of code online but my implementation still doesnt seem to decrease the loss of the model … in another world with my smartphone my animeWebLogistic regression has two phases: training: We train the system (specically the weights w and b) using stochastic gradient descent and the cross-entropy loss. gradient descent webm wikimedia Making statements based on opinion; back them up with references or personal experience. When building GLMs in practice, Rs glm command and statsmodels ... in another world with my smartphone qartuladWebGradient Ascent Optimization Once we have an equation for Log Likelihood, we chose the values for our parameters (q) that maximize said function. In the case of logistic regression we can’t solve for q mathematically. Instead we use a computer to chose q. To do so we employ an algorithm called gradient ascent. That algorithms claims that if you inbox msnWebFeb 15, 2024 · The loss function (also known as a cost function) is a function that is used to measure how much your prediction differs from the labels. Binary cross entropy is the … in another world with my smartphone netflixWebcost -- negative log-likelihood cost for logistic regression. dw -- gradient of the loss with respect to w, thus same shape as w. db -- gradient of the loss with respect to b, thus same shape as b. My Code: import numpy as np def sigmoid(z): """ Compute the sigmoid of z Arguments: z -- A scalar or numpy array of any size. in another world with my smartphone olgaWebMay 11, 2024 · Derive logistic loss gradient in matrix form. Asked 5 years, 10 months ago. Modified 5 years, 10 months ago. Viewed 6k times. 3. User Antoni Parellada had a … inbox nagercoilWebMar 14, 2024 · 时间:2024-03-14 02:27:27 浏览:0. 使用梯度下降优化方法,编程实现 logistic regression 算法的步骤如下:. 定义 logistic regression 模型,包括输入特征、权重参数和偏置参数。. 定义损失函数,使用交叉熵损失函数。. 使用梯度下降法更新模型参数,包括权重参数和偏置 ... in another world with my smartphone neko sama